首页
/ LiveSplit服务器功能解析:WebSocket与TCP连接方式对比

LiveSplit服务器功能解析:WebSocket与TCP连接方式对比

2025-07-09 07:50:50作者:田桥桑Industrious

背景介绍

LiveSplit作为一款流行的速度跑计时工具,其服务器功能允许外部程序通过不同协议与计时器进行交互。近期开发版本中新增了WebSocket服务器支持,为用户提供了更多连接选择。

服务器连接方式对比

TCP服务器

  • 传统网络连接方式
  • 通过Control菜单中的"Start TCP Server"选项启用
  • 使用标准TCP/IP协议进行通信
  • 适合本地网络环境使用

WebSocket服务器

  • 新增于开发版本中的功能
  • 提供基于Web标准的实时双向通信
  • 特别适合浏览器客户端集成
  • 解决某些环境不支持TCP连接的限制

功能差异说明

WebSocket服务器与TCP服务器在LiveSplit中不能同时运行,用户需要根据实际需求选择适合的连接方式。WebSocket的出现主要解决了浏览器环境下的连接限制问题,为网页应用集成LiveSplit功能提供了可能。

使用建议

对于需要浏览器集成的开发者或用户,建议:

  1. 下载LiveSplit开发版本
  2. 通过Control菜单启用WebSocket服务器
  3. 使用标准的WebSocket客户端进行连接

对于传统桌面应用集成,TCP服务器仍然是稳定可靠的选择。用户应根据具体应用场景和技术栈选择合适的连接方式。

未来展望

随着Web技术的普及,WebSocket支持将为LiveSplit带来更广泛的应用场景,特别是在跨平台和网页集成方面具有显著优势。这项功能的加入标志着LiveSplit在现代化进程中的重要一步。

登录后查看全文
热门项目推荐
相关项目推荐